A processable hybrid supramolecular polymer formed by base pair modified polyoxometalate clusters.
A new type of organic–inorganic hybrid supramolecular polymer has been prepared by using the base group modified polyoxometalate clusters as monomers, where the hydrogen bonds between the complementary base pairs act as the driving force.
